6they said to him, “Then say ‘Shibboleth.’ ” And he said, “Sibboleth,” for he could not 12:6 Lit speak thus. The difference in pronunciation was between a Hebrew consonant with an “sh” sound, which the Ephraimites evidently did not have in their dialect, and another consonant with a sharp “s” sound. This difference was similar to that between the Hebrew greeting “Shalom,” and the greeting “Salaam” used in Islamic circles. Shibboleth has even been accepted into English as a word meaning “a peculiarity of pronunciation.” In Hebrew it refers to an ear or head of grain.pronounce it correctly. Then they seized him and killed him at the fords of the Jordan. At that time forty-two thousand of the Ephraimites fell.
